Wiktionary
FOYER, noun. A lobby, corridor, or waiting room, used in a hotel, theater, etc.
FOYER, noun. The crucible or basin in a furnace which receives the molten metal.
FOYER, noun. (UK) A hostel offering accommodation and work opportunities to homeless young people.
Dictionary definition
FOYER, noun. A large entrance or reception room or area.
